猿代码 — 科研/AI模型/高性能计算
0

CUDA在生物信息学中的应用是什么?

【协议班】签约入职国家超算中心/研究院      点击进入

【全家桶】超算/高性能计算 — 算力时代必学!      点击进入

【超算运维】AI模型时代网络工程师必备技能!      点击进入

【科研实习】考研/求职/留学 通关利器!      点击进入


生物信息学是一门复杂的学科,它涉及到大量的数据分析与计算。为了解决这些问题,许多生物信息学家开始使用GPU加速技术,其中最著名的就是CUDA。


CUDA是一种由NVIDIA开发的并行计算平台和编程模型,可以用来加速数据密集型应用程序。在生物信息学领域,CUDA已经得到了广泛的应用,因为它可以处理许多生物学家需要处理的海量数据。


CUDA主要是通过利用GPU的并行计算能力来加速生物信息学中的计算任务。GPU比CPU具有更多的核心和更高的内存带宽,这使得它们可以更快地处理大量的数据。这使得CUDA非常适合于生物信息学中的大规模数据分析,如DNA测序、蛋白质结构预测等。


在DNA测序方面,CUDA可以用来加速DNA序列比对、基因组装和变异检测等任务。使用CUDA进行DNA测序比对时,可以将读取和比对分成多个并行任务,并将它们放在不同的GPU核心上。这样可以极大地提高比对的速度。


在蛋白质结构预测方面,CUDA可以用来加速分子动力学模拟和蒙特卡罗模拟等任务。这些任务需要大量的计算资源,而CUDA可以使用GPU的并行计算能力来加速这些计算。


除了DNA测序和蛋白质结构预测外,CUDA还可以用于其他生物信息学任务。例如,它可以用于加速基因表达数据的分析、图像处理和机器学习任务等。


总的来说,CUDA在生物信息学中的应用是非常广泛的。它可以使用GPU的并行计算能力来加速生物信息学任务,从而使得研究人员能够更快地进行大规模的数据分析和计算。因此,CUDA已经成为许多生物信息学家必备的工具之一。



猿代码 — 超算人才制造局 | 培养超算/高性能计算人才,助力解决“卡脖子 !

说点什么...

已有0条评论

最新评论...

本文作者
2024-1-18 22:55
  • 0
    粉丝
  • 316
    阅读
  • 0
    回复
作者其他文章
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)